OpenLogi
⚡️ A native, local-first alternative to Logitech Options+, written in Rust 🦀
Unlock the full capabilities of Logitech mice, keyboards, and webcams over HID++ and UVC
Fed up with Options+? Try OpenLogi.
Runs on macOS, Linux, and Windows.

Features
- Devices connected over Logi Bolt receivers, Unifying receivers, Bluetooth, or a wired connection, with battery percentage and charge state
- Button remapping via the OS input hook: a built-in action catalog plus custom keyboard shortcuts authored in the TOML config¹
- Per-application profile overlays that auto-switch on app focus (macOS + Windows; Linux on X11 / XWayland only)
- Litra lights: power, brightness, and color temperature, with optional auto power that follows camera activity
Mouse
- Capture and remap the middle, mode-shift, and thumbwheel buttons (middle everywhere, the rest where the device exposes them)
- Per-direction gesture bindings with live capture, on any capable button
- Actions Ring: a cursor-centred, eight-slot overlay of actions (
ShowActionsRing), with per-application layouts - DPI control with presets and Cycle / Set-preset actions (
0x2201) - SmartShift wheel: mode toggle, sensitivity, and a permanent-ratchet panel (
0x2111) - Per-device native scroll inversion (
0x2121, supported devices)
Keyboard
- Global F-key remapping: the same action catalog as the mouse, plus power-user actions — typed text, key combos, multi-step workflows (macOS + Windows)
- Static RGB lighting (
0x8070/0x8080, supported devices)
Camera
- Any Logitech UVC webcam (Brio, StreamCam, the C920 series, …), plug and play
- Live preview that opens the camera only while you watch — leaving it releases the camera entirely and the LED goes off
- Image controls written straight to the UVC hardware — zoom, focus, exposure, brightness, contrast, saturation, sharpness, white balance, tint, anti-flicker, and low-light compensation, with auto-mode toggles for focus / exposure / white balance — so changes apply in Meet / Zoom / OBS and every other app using the camera
- One-click profiles: built-in Default / Streaming / Video call plus custom snapshots; settings persist per camera and are written back to the hardware on the next view
¹ Media key actions use D-Bus MPRIS on Linux; a handful of macOS-specific actions have no universal Linux equivalent and are no-ops. Windows maps platform actions to native equivalents where available.
Install
[!IMPORTANT] Quit Logi Options+ first: the two applications fight over HID++ access, and only one can own a given receiver at a time.
macOS
Requires macOS 13 or later.
Download the signed, notarized .dmg from the latest release and drag OpenLogi.app to /Applications.
Or install via Homebrew:
brew install --cask openlogi
The official Homebrew cask is the default installation path. To explicitly
track the latest GitHub release from aprilnea/tap instead:
brew tap aprilnea/tap
brew install --cask aprilnea/tap/openlogi@latest
openlogi@latest is maintained by OpenLogi's release workflow and may update
before the official cask autobump lands. Install either openlogi or
openlogi@latest, not both.
Linux
Download the package for your distribution from the latest release:
# Debian / Ubuntu
sudo dpkg -i openlogi_*.deb
# Fedora / RHEL
sudo rpm -i openlogi-*.rpm
# Arch Linux
sudo pacman -U openlogi-*.pkg.tar.zst
Packages are published for both x86_64/amd64 and arm64/aarch64.
Pre-built packages require GLIBC 2.35 or newer (Ubuntu 22.04 baseline).
NixOS users can instead import the repository's module, which installs the package and udev rules and starts the agent with the graphical session:
{
inputs.nixpkgs.url = "github:NixOS/nixpkgs/nixos-unstable";
inputs.openlogi = {
url = "github:AprilNEA/OpenLogi";
inputs.nixpkgs.follows = "nixpkgs";
};
outputs = { nixpkgs, openlogi, ... }: {
nixosConfigurations.my-host = nixpkgs.lib.nixosSystem {
system = "x86_64-linux"; # or aarch64-linux
modules = [
openlogi.nixosModules.default
{ programs.openlogi.enable = true; }
];
};
};
}
All Linux packages install udev rules that grant your user access to
/dev/hidraw*, /dev/uinput and your Logitech mouse's /dev/input/event*
node without sudo. The NixOS module starts the agent automatically; after a
.deb, .rpm, or .pkg.tar.zst installation, enable it for your user:
systemctl --user enable --now openlogi-agent.service
See docs/INSTALL-linux.md for complete NixOS options, manual / source installs, and distros without systemd.
Windows
Signed portable .zip archives and per-user .msi installers (x86_64 and
arm64) are attached to each release. Both ship the GUI (OpenLogi.exe)
together with the background agent (openlogi-agent.exe), which owns all
device I/O. Keep the two files side by side when using the portable zip, or
the GUI has nothing to connect to.
Windows support has been validated end-to-end on Windows 11 with real
hardware (a wired keyboard and a Unifying-receiver mouse), including
install, in-place upgrade, and uninstall of the MSI. It is newer than the
macOS build, so if you hit a rough edge please
report it. The agent shows a
system-tray icon (Show Main Window / Quit) so the app stays reachable after
the main window is closed. To disable it on Windows, set
show_in_menu_bar = false in the TOML [app_settings] block and restart the
agent; the GUI toggle is currently macOS-only.
